January 2022 by Dah Reviewer
The store has primarily two components: groceries and ready made food. It is a kosher supermarket so understandably the prices are not low. I do feel, however, that for some things they are exorbitant, for no reason. Ready made food is hit or miss. Some things are good, others barely edible. Regardless, if you are health conscience this is not a place to take out food from. Selection of kosher products is pretty good, especially for a relatively small store. Overall: with little to no competition for Kosher markets, Glatt 27 is alright, but charges too high prices due to lack of competition.
